Wrestling Camp: Who is going to be Pacific's next wrestling state champion? Attending wrestling camp is a start in the right direction. Wrestling campers will be taught the fundamentals of wrestling. During camp, the high school coaching staff will instruct campers on basic to complex maneuvers on the mat.

Camp Staff: The head coaches and their assistants from each particular sport conduct the camps. Additionally, for the younger camps, high school student athletes will assist the staff.

School Physicals: Physicals are not required for summer camps. However, athletes are required to have a current physical in order to participate in middle school and high school athletics during the 2025-2026 school year. PHS physical day will be held by Orris family chiropractic on June 3rd, from 2:00pm-6:00pm, in the PHS Library. The cost for a physical is $25.00.
